Wie kann ich bei der Verbindung von A nach C über B PEM auf B angeben?

Wie kann ich bei der Verbindung von A nach C über B PEM auf B angeben?

Ich versuche, über B eine Verbindung zum Server C herzustellen. Wie kann ich den Schlüssel für B bereitstellen?

dh:

ssh -J [email protected]:22[<-need to use PEM on B] [email protected]

Das Terminal von sshtunnel ist auf /bin/true eingestellt – ich kann mich also authentifizieren, aber nicht anmelden.

Antwort1

Erstellen Sie eine Datei ~/.ssh/config mit dem Inhalt:

host 10.0.0.146
  HostName hostb
  IdentifyFile ~/.ssh/id_rsa_hostb.pub
  User sshtunnel

Jetzt können Sie verwenden:

ssh -J 10.0.0.146 [email protected]

verwandte Informationen